The goal for series of blog postings is to provide you with a very fast and simple way to write the first iteration of your plan. This is a basic and rough outline of the business concept. You should not waste time trying to estimate the net profit down to the exact penny. This is information you don’t yet know. For now, set aside a limited amount of time to write a very short business plan that outlines the most basic of facts. Just get the essentials in order. Think of this exercise as akin to developing a concept paper that frames the first pass at your business model. You might want to limit the number of pages to ten or less (less is better), just to keep the concept contained and your time limited.
Six Basic Business Plan Topics
A fast business plan briefly (and I mean briefly) addresses six topics. The following is a writing exercise, complete with simple writing assignments. You should complete this assignment in hours, not days. The point is to write a paragraph on each topic to help you think through the basic concepts of your business and get it down on paper. You don’t need to buy business plan writing software yet. Wait until you’ve convinced yourself that the idea is viable.
To begin, you can simply start writing notes in a notebook or typing your thoughts into a word processing program. You can layout the financial section in a spreadsheet if you prefer. Using a spreadsheet is helpful but not necessary yet. You’ll be creating sections that address six topic areas.
The six basic topic areas that you’ll write about are:
- The Business Idea
- Products or Services
- Marketing
- Management and Operations
- Financial Forecasts
- Writing The Executive Summary
For now, focus on writing just a paragraph or two for each topic. Writing these sections gives you the chance to think through each topic and begin to clearly define the company. Focus on just getting the basic idea down.

In each section you’ll be given a series of simple questions to answer, laid out in the form of a writing assignment. Try answering the questions briefly, then come back later and expand on each point. Don’t get bogged down on any one question. If you don’t know the answer, just make a note that you need to research that topic and come back to it later. Most importantly, just keep writing…
